📣Pub Alert! Here I causally identify (one of the only outside of the USA) a negative effect of a voter ID pilot scheme from 2018. This scheme was less restrictive than that used at the 2024 GE, implying a greater proportion of people were excluded from voting in June and a fairer system is needed.

The election proved the narrative wrong. For the Linke the election was a huge success while BSW failed to make it above the 5%-threshold. The Linke managed to win young progressives especially in cities. Ironically, this would probably not have been possbile had Wagenkencht stayed in the party
